WebMar 16, 2024 · 1 Answer Sorted by: 5 It depends a lot on the \documentclass you are using. But for the standard classes ( book, article, etc.) this should suffice. Add this line: \addcontentsline {toc} {section} {Listings} right before \lstlistoflistings. This will probably not work for other classes. If it doesn't work, please tell which class you are using.

LaTeX can organize, number, and index chapters and sections of document. There are up to 7 levels of depth for defining sections depending on the document class: Usually, \section is the top-level document command in most documents. However, in reports or books, and similar long documents, this would be \chapter or \part . jecsdWebbibtexkey A unique string used to refer to the entry in LaTeX documents.
